Article: ROBBERY SUSPECT WAS WEARING A BULLETPROOF VEST, POLICE SAY.(LOCAL)

Byline: JANIE BRYANT, STAFF WRITER

PORTSMOUTH -- The 19-year-old man arrested in connection with a Monday morning robbery of an Almost-A-Banc was wearing a bulletproof vest, police said Tuesday.

Wearing body armor while committing a serious crime is a felony, according to police spokeswoman Amber Whittaker.

Whittaker said she believes this is the first time in about four years that someone has been charged with the offense in Portsmouth.
